I am trying to retrieve Map content via WFS Geoserver connection in Java with Geotools 18.4. But I am getting the following error: Content type is required for org.geotools.data.ows.Response.

The idea is that i want to map features (Position and Heartrate of a running person) of a WFS Layer with the java processing library.

I would be very grateful if someone can help me with this error.

here is the code:

`

import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.Serializable;
import java.util.HashMap;
import java.util.Map;

import org.geotools.data.DataStore;
import org.geotools.data.wfs.WFSDataStoreFactory;

public class Heartrate2 {

  public static void main(String[] args) throws IOException {
    Heartrate2 me = new Heartrate2();
    DataStore ds = me.dataStoreWFS();
    for (String n:ds.getTypeNames()) {
      System.out.println(n);
    }
  }

public DataStore dataStoreWFS() {
    DataStore dataStore = null;

    try {
        Map<String, Serializable> connectionParameters = new HashMap<>();
        String getCapabilities = "http://webgis.regione.sardegna.it/geoserver/ows?service=WFS&request=GetCapabilities";
        String variableCapabilities = "WFSDataStoreFactory:GET_CAPABILITIES_URL";

        connectionParameters.put(variableCapabilities, getCapabilities);

        dataStore = (new WFSDataStoreFactory()).createDataStore(connectionParameters);
        } catch (IOException e) {
            e.printStackTrace();
            }
    return dataStore;
    }
}

`
